Cut Down on Hydroplaning While Driving

Hydroplaning represents a severe hazard for drivers. Once a vehicle hydroplanes, getting it under control becomes difficult. A crash may then become likely. Drivers should learn defensive skills to deal with hydroplaning and also learn about ways to avoid the situation from occurring.

Unfortunately, reducing the chances of hydroplaning to zero might not be possible in bad weather. Wet roads can become slick, causing vehicles to slide or skid. Keep clear of puddles and staying far from the road's edge, a spot where water collects. Avoiding obvious wet spots on the road seems advisable.

How Can You Figure Out If A Car's Tires Need To Be Replaced?

A flat tire is bad enough. Experiencing a blowout on the road, however, could prove fatal. Keep this in mind when thinking about car care. Knowing when your tires are due for replacing could cut down the chances of running into dire tire troubles.

Checking the tread depth on tires reflects the most common tire care step to take. With a Lincoln penny, a driver can get an idea about remaining depth. If you see the top of Abe's head, the treads are low. That means the tires aren't likely to deliver decent traction.

Do You Have An Exhaust Leak? Easy Ways To Figure It Out

A couple of quick tips can help you identify an exhaust leak before it becomes a bigger problem in your life. The more that you pay attention to these tips, the better off you will be.

Gas Pedal Vibration- When you detect vibration in the gas pedal, you may have an exhaust leak on your hands. The leak can cause vibration throughout the whole vehicle, and this is true even if the leak is rather small. Make sure you get this checked out right away if it seems to be an issue.

Easily Test Your Vehicle's Battery Voltage

Testing your car's battery is an easy procedure that can give you a good idea of whether or not you need to replace it.

Testing for Voltage

Make sure your voltmeter is set to measure in voltage. With the vehicle turned off touch the red positive test lead on the voltmeter to the positive terminal on the battery; at the same time touch the black negative test lead to the black terminal on the battery. This should give you an accurate reading of how much voltage your battery is putting out.
